+/*
+ * When we start the rotation of a channel, we add its information in
+ * channel_pending_rotate_ht. This is called in the context of
+ * thread_manage_client when the client asks for a rotation, in the context
+ * of the sessiond_timer thread when periodic rotations are enabled and from
+ * the rotation_thread when size-based rotations are enabled.
+ */
+int rotate_add_channel_pending(uint64_t key, enum lttng_domain_type domain,
+               struct ltt_session *session);
+
+/*
+ * Subscribe/unsubscribe the notification_channel from the rotation_thread to
+ * session usage notifications to perform size-based rotations.
+ */
+int subscribe_session_consumed_size_rotation(struct ltt_session *session,
+               uint64_t size,
+               struct notification_thread_handle *notification_thread_handle);
+int unsubscribe_session_consumed_size_rotation(struct ltt_session *session,
+               struct notification_thread_handle *notification_thread_handle);
